Список инструкций
Список инструкций системы S7-300, CPU 31xC, CPU 31x, IM 151-7, BM 147-1, BM 147-2
A5E00105517-04 101
Инструкция Операнд Описание
Длина
(слов)
Типичное время выполнения,
мкс
312 31x, 147,
151
317
JN LABEL
Переход, если "результат≠0" (CC 1=1 и CC 0=0)
или (CC 1=0) и (CC 0=1)
1
1)
/2 3.8 1.9 0,51
JMZ LABEL
Переход, если "результат≤0" (CC 1=0 и CC 0=1)
или (CC 1=0 и CC 0=0)
2 3.8 1.9 0,51
JPZ LABEL
Переход, если "результат≥0" (CC 1=1 и CC 0=0)
или (CC 1=0) и (CC 0=0)
2 3.8 1.9 0,51
Слово состояния для: JN, JMZ, JPZ
BR CC 1 CC 0 OV OS OR STA RLO FC
Инструкция зависит: - Да Да - - - - - -
Инструкция влияет: - - - - - - - - -
JL LABEL Распределитель переходов (Jump distributor).
Данная инструкция выполняется в соответствии
со списком операторов перехода. Операндом
является метка перехода к следующим
операторам этого списка. ACCU1–L содержит
номер выполняемой инструкции перехода.
2 5.0 2.5 0,78
LOOP LABEL Декрементирование значения в ACCU1–L и
переход, если ACCU1–L≠0 (программир. циклов)
2 3.5 1.8 0,30
Слово состояния для: JL, LOOP
BR CC 1 CC 0 OV OS OR STA RLO FC
Инструкция зависит: - - - - - - - - -
Инструкция влияет: - - - - - - - - -
1
Для размера в одно слово длина перехода лежит в пределах (–128 ... +127)